Six-Year-Old Girl Shot Inside Her Home by Random Gunfire in Fort Washington

Jeff Jones

FORT WASHINGTON, MD – Gunshots rang out Monday night in Fort Washington and as a result, a six-year-old girl and an adult male were both struck by gunfire.

The Prince George’s Police Department’s Fort Washington Division VII investigators are investigating a shooting that occurred Monday evening in Fort Washington. A six-year-old girl and an adult male were struck by the gunfire. 

According to police, at approximately 8:55 pm, officers received a 911 call for two gunshot victims who were being driven to a hospital in a private vehicle to be treated for gunshot wounds.

“The preliminary investigation revealed that the victims had been shot at a home in the . Detectives responded to the scene and assumed the investigation,” police reported. “The adult male and the juvenile victim remain in the hospital in critical condition. Suspect(s) and motive for the shooting remain under investigation. Preliminarily, detectives do not believe this was a random shooting. The young girl was not an intended target.”
